Gathering Sugarcane





Gathering sugarcane is a vital action in the walking stick sugar processing chain, as it straight influences the high quality and yield of the final item. Appropriate timing and methods are essential throughout this phase to make sure optimal sugar material and minimize losses. Commonly, sugarcane is harvested when it gets to maturity, usually 12 to 18 months after planting, characterized by a high sucrose concentration.

Hands-on harvesting involves proficient workers making use of machetes to cut the walking stick, guaranteeing marginal damages to the stalks. Alternatively, mechanical harvesting uses specialized equipment to reduce and accumulate the walking cane effectively.


Post-harvest, the sugarcane must be refined swiftly to stop sucrose degradation. Ideally, harvested walking cane needs to be transferred to refining facilities within 24-hour to maintain sugar quality. Therefore, efficient logistical planning is important to maintain the honesty of the collected plant throughout the supply chain.

Filtration Techniques



The purification methods employed in walking stick sugar handling are essential for changing the raw juice right into a high-quality sugar product. These approaches largely aim to remove pollutants, such as soil, plant materials, and inorganic substances, which can negatively affect the last item's flavor and color.


This process entails including lime and heat to the raw juice, which facilitates the coagulation of impurities. Additionally, the use of phosphoric acid can boost the clarification procedure by further binding contaminations.


One more significant technique is carbonatation, where carbon dioxide is introduced to the clarified juice. This response creates calcium carbonate, which click this link catches continuing to be impurities and advertises their removal.


In addition, triggered carbon therapy might be related to adsorb any staying colorants and organic pollutants, making sure a much more refined product. The combination of these techniques properly prepares the sugar juice for succeeding actions in the refining process, setting the stage for the manufacturing of high-quality walking cane sugar.


Condensation Approaches



After the filtration phase, the next crucial action in walking cane sugar processing involves crystallization methods, which play a pivotal function in transforming the cleared up juice into solid sugar. This process normally employs 2 main approaches: spontaneous formation and controlled formation.


In spontaneous formation, supersaturated sugar options are enabled to cool normally, leading to the formation of sugar crystals over time. This method is less complex yet might lead to irregular crystal sizes and reduced pureness degrees. On the other hand, controlled condensation is a much more precise strategy where temperature level, seeding, and focus agents are carefully taken care of. This approach enables the uniform development of sugar crystals and greater pureness.


Throughout condensation, the made clear juice is concentrated via dissipation, enhancing its sugar material till it gets to supersaturation.
